要在ST语言中创建自定义类型,可以使用TYPE语句。下面是一个示例:

TYPE MyType :
    STRUCT
        field1 : INT;
        field2 : REAL;
    END_STRUCT;
END_TYPE

在这个示例中,我们创建了一个名为MyType的自定义类型。它包含了两个字段:field1和field2,分别是整数类型(INT)和实数类型(REAL)。你可以根据需要自定义其他类型的字段。

创建自定义类型后,你可以在程序中使用它来声明变量,例如:

VAR
    myVariable : MyType;

这样,myVariable就是一个MyType类型的变量。你可以使用点号操作符来访问其字段,例如:

myVariable.field1 := 10;
myVariable.field2 := 3.14;

通过这种方式,你可以在ST语言中创建和使用自定义类型。

ST语言自定义类型创建

原文地址: https://www.cveoy.top/t/topic/h7tm 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录